Barcelona legend Xavi admits he would relish the challenge of managing former team-mates like Lionel Messi and Sergio Busquets at the club.

Current boss Ernesto Valverde is under huge pressure at Camp Nou, which was heightened after their 2-0 defeat at Granada on Saturday.

Xavi has been linked with the job in various quarters but insists his main focus remains in Qatar with Al-Sadd.

“The only thing that worries me now is doing well here (Al-Sadd), winning titles and making mistakes in some aspects to learn for the future,” he told Ara.

“It wouldn’t be a problem to manager Barcelona. I know what Messi is like, and Suárez, Busquets, Jordi Alba, Piqué or Sergi Roberto.

“I know how they train, their capacity for leadership, I can tell if they are sad or angry. I hope to have this relationship with players as a coach.

“Messi is a player who, if you convince him, he can even be a brilliant defender,” the 39-year-old added. “He has everything.

“If you convince him to run, what will the others do? They will run twice as much.”

Barça host Villarreal on Tuesday, before travelling to Getafe on September 28.
